Description[?]:
We, the Conservative Federalist Party of Deltaria, seek to attain unity among our nation's people and promote liberty and freedom in society. Our party is fiscally, socially, and otherwise conservative on most issues. Some of our hallmark beliefs are: -Trust in a laissez-faire economic system. -A small national government bureaucratic system. -A true federalist balance between power vested in the regional governments, the head of government, and the national forum. -Adherence to the separation of church and state, while still maintaining general moral principles in government. Other than in ceremony, no one religion is to be preferred over another. -Belief in universal and relatively un-restricted civil rights. -A fairly internationalist governmental system that maintains a strong military and the ability to intervene in world affairs as a global leader if need be. -Strictly conservative social and moral policies. -Faith in a capitalist system. |
